1. When and How much to post?

Focus on quality instead of quantity/volume. Posting less can increase your engagements. Chances are you will share the best content if you post once or at best twice daily. Anything above 2 posts per day is not a good idea for Facebook. Your views per share of content will get divided. GIFS work best on Twitter while hashtags work best on Instagram, but none works on Facebook. 

Post timings differ from one brand to another. Your target audience determines which is the best time to post on Facebook. If your target age demographic is school/college kids, you better post on weekends. 

2. What to Post?

You should try videos as part of your content strategy. Videos can leverage the kind of engagements you are looking for. Most Facebook users scroll through their newsfeed and stop only at a video. 

Moreover, videos are worth more than 60,000 written words. Better expression leads to better engagement/impression rates on Facebook. 

3. Going Live More Often

Live videos are ranked higher than the ones which are not. Moreover, people comment more on live videos than on any other videos on Facebook. When you go live, your followers will check your non-live content. That way your overall engagement on Facebook is bound to rise. 

Here are a few things you should try while going live – 

  • Show your followers behind the scenes of your processes, events, or your office space
  • Let your audience interact with you through a Q&A session. 
  • Bring in experts from your industry and conduct a fun one-to-one interview
  • You can demonstrate concepts and products best on a live show
  • Discuss upcoming events and launches
  • Share tips with your followers

4. Curated Content 

Share user-submitted photos and content on your Facebook Page as a buffer. Many times you may not even find something suitable to post. Sharing something useful is key here. Information related to your niche need not always come from your web page alone. 

Sharing other’s content may feel weird at first. But, trust us when we say it will increase your engagements. The idea is to share relatable content. If you are a cosmetics company, you may want to share valuable tips shared by the company Mac. User-generated content has huge potential too.

5. Experiment 

Do not forget to experiment with brand-new kinds of content. Your Facebook page will likely become dormant if you do not experiment. 

You can try Coca-Cola’s budgeting rule of 70/20/10 for marketing. 

  • 70% of low-risk traditional marketing
  • 20% of new & innovative, deeply engaging content that resonates with some users
  • 10% high-reward to high-risk ratio purely experimental content that may or may not become viral

6. Giveaways 

That’s actually a great way to gain more Facebook followers and increase your engagement. People engage better if you put up a prize for some contest. Giveaways are perfect if you are trying to capture the market sooner. 

If your page is new do not post giveaways that may seem too good to be true. That is why giveaways testimonial videos and your resharing that becomes vital. People must have faith in their giveaways. Too many conditions labeled on your giveaways contests may put people off. 

Giveaways are perfect to hold on to your audience for a longer time. 

7. Comment Replies 

Replying to comments can be one of the better ways to engage an audience. Treasure comments from your followers. It does not matter if these comments are good or bad. 

If someone is complaining of bad service from your end, you should definitely comment back. Do not sound harsh, monotonous, and sarcastic in your comment replies. Offer to resolve any issues. 

Replying to good comments is also important. Strike a conversation, if need be.
